Friday Night Funkin’ is a rhythm game akin to DDR but with a keyboard. Originally a browser game created by ninjamuffin99, it became a game you can download onto your PC for free. It has many contributors throughout the Newgrounds community from art, to music, to coding. Newgrounds is a website that fostered an artistic community that has created many classic flash games and animations from the early 2000s that sparked the careers of many animators you may know of now. Some Newgrounds community characters come into Friday Night Funkin’ as rivals to face on stage as a result. Official levels are continuing to be added along with a huge modding scene that everyone is hopping onto. Gameplay consists of hitting the right notes as they come up on your side of the screen; up, down, left, and right. You face opponents who are “rap battling” you so you can win the favor of your girlfriend. Each “week” (level) consists of 2 to 3 songs that you have to complete to continue to the next week. Veterans of rhythm games can find moderate challenge in Hard mode but for those with slower reaction times you can change the weeks to normal or easy. If you miss too many notes the bar on the bottom of the screen will fill red and you will need to restart from the beginning of that song. Thankfully to the left of the screen your opponent shows the notes you will have to hit before they come to your side of the screen; a bit of a preview. Although the mechanics are simple, the main attraction of the game is the funk!

With tons of tracks with more and more being added over time the selection of music is all custom made for the game. Similar to Banjo and Kazooie dialogue or Animal Crossing characters rapping it’s a bit odd at first but after enough play time it’ll start to grow on you. Almost like listening to music in a foreign language, you may not understand the words but it sure is funky! There’s more than enough tracks to keep you entertained for hours, but if that’s not enough the modding scene is very active and has attracted all kinds of creators to make an amazing community passion project! Some of the more popular ones being the “Whitty Mod” or the “Tricky Mod”. If you are a Newgrounds Veteran you’ll be overjoyed to see some of your favorite classic characters breaking it down on stage, along with a cast of new and beautifully animated characters; each with their own original songs that will get stuck in your head all day.
